Say NO to Bad Power Banks: The Ultimate Red Flags List
Power banks are Stay away from this fraud power bank lifesavers when your phone dies, but choosing a bad one can be as disastrous as getting stuck with a dead battery. Luckily, there are telltale signs to help you avoid those power bank fiascoes.
- A cost that seems too good to be true can often indicate a subpar product.
- Pay attention to reviews from other users – they can give you valuable clues about the power bank's performance.
- Avoid brands that you don't know unless they have strong reviews from reputable sources.
- Double-check the power bank has a built-in safety circuit to protect your devices from overcharging and damage.
- Trusted power bank should charge your devices quickly and efficiently.
